Как устроены текущие площадки

  • Articles
  • April 29, 2026
  • 0

Как устроены текущие площадки

Текущий сайт являет собой комплекс взаимодействующих элементов. Пользователь наблюдает готовую страницу в браузере, но за этим стоит сложная структура. Портал состоит из заметной компоненты интерфейса, и закрытой серверной логики.

Клиентская сторона охватывает разметку, стили и скрипты. Браузер получает файлы, обрабатывает код и отображает наполнение. Серверная часть отвечает за сохранение информации и выполнение требований. Между этими частями ведётся регулярный передача информацией.

Архитектура веб-приложений опирается на протокол HTTP. Пользователь посылает требование, сервер выполняет его и выдаёт итог. Текущие казино вулкан задействуют асинхронные методы для повышения скорости.

Проектирование предполагает владения разнообразия технологий. Фронтенд-специалисты выстраивают интерфейс, бэкенд-разработчики программируют серверную обработку. Все компоненты должны функционировать слаженно для обеспечения оперативной и устойчивой деятельности портала.

Из чего образуется текущий сайт

Сайт выстраивается из ряда технологических уровней. Фундаментальный слой создаёт HTML – язык разметки, устанавливающий архитектуру документа. Разметка формирует заголовки, абзацы, списки и иные компоненты страницы.

Второй пласт представляет CSS — каскадные таблицы стилей. Этот язык обеспечивает за зрительное оформление: окраску, шрифты, отступы, расположение контейнеров. Стили формируют страницу привлекательной и удобной для восприятия.

Третий составляющая – JavaScript, язык программирования для формирования динамики. Сценарии перехватывают действия юзера, корректируют наполнение без перезагрузки, проверяют поданные информацию.

Серверная сторона включает программный код на PHP, Python, Java или других технологиях. Бэкенд выполняет бизнес-логику и оперирует с хранилищами информации. Актуальные вулкан россии применяют реляционные или документо-ориентированные базы для структурирования информации.

Дополнительно используются медиафайлы: графика, видео, шрифты и иконки. Все элементы загружаются по индивидуальным запросам и объединяются браузером в целостную страницу.

Клиент и сервер: как осуществляется взаимодействие информацией

Взаимодействие между браузером и сервером базируется на архитектуре клиент-сервер. Браузер отправляет обращения, сервер обрабатывает их и выдаёт ответы. Весь алгоритм выполняется по протоколу HTTP или его защищенной вариации HTTPS.

Когда посетитель указывает ссылку, генерируется HTTP-запрос. Обращение включает метод, заголовки и временами тело с информацией. DNS-сервер переводит доменное имя в IP-адрес, после чего браузер инициирует связь.

Сервер перехватывает запрос и обрабатывает его контент. Программный код распознаёт требуемые манипуляции: скачать документ, обслужить форму, получить информацию из хранилища. После завершения процедур создаётся HTTP-ответ с индикатором статуса и наполнением.

Ответ возвращается браузеру, который интерпретирует переданные сведения. HTML-разметка интерпретируется, CSS накладывается к элементам, JavaScript исполняется. Если страница содержит отсылки на файлы, браузер отправляет вспомогательные обращения.

Современные решения задействуют AJAX для асинхронного передачи. Механизм предоставляет модифицировать секции страницы без целой перезагрузки, а vulkan russia получает информацию и обновляет интерфейс динамически.

HTML как каркас: архитектура и значение страниц

HTML задаёт структуру веб-страницы через систему маркеров. Каждый элемент обозначает конкретный элемент: заголовок, параграф, ссылку, графику. Браузер интерпретирует разметку и генерирует объектную представление документа.

Семантические теги характеризуют предназначение частей наполнения. Тег header определяет заголовок страницы, nav — навигацию, main — главное материал, footer — подвал. Поисковики механизмы изучают смысловую нагрузку для определения построения.

Ключевые компоненты HTML включают:

  • Заглавия от h1 до h6 для упорядочивания
  • Абзацы p для письменных элементов
  • Списки ul, ol, li для нумераций
  • Гиперссылки a для навигации
  • Изображения img для изображений
  • Формы form, input для получения сведений

Параметры дополняют возможности элементов. Параметр class назначает класс для дизайна, id создаёт ID, href задаёт путь. Актуальные вулкан россия эксплуатируют data-атрибуты для хранения сведений.

Верная разметка удовлетворяет спецификациям W3C. Корректная построение повышает применимость для людей с суженными возможностями.

CSS как слой представления: адаптивность и зрительный стиль

CSS контролирует зрительным видом веб-страниц. Стили формируют палитру, шрифты, габариты, интервалы и позиционирование компонентов. Обособление материала и оформления обеспечивает изменять дизайн без модификации разметки.

Выборщики обозначают, к каким компонентам применяются директивы. Классы оформляют наборы элементов, ID — уникальные секции. Псевдоклассы обозначают условия: ховер, фокус, активность.

Резиновый стиль обеспечивает верное показ на разных гаджетах. Медиазапросы активируют оформление в зависимости от ширины монитора и расположения. Гибкие системы на основе flexbox и grid генерируют динамические макеты, адаптирующиеся под параметры браузера.

Препроцессоры Sass и Less вносят переменные, вложенность и миксины. Эти технологии ускоряют создание масштабных файлов правил. Компиляция преобразует код в стандартный CSS.

Современные вулкан россии применяют CSS-анимации для формирования постепенных изменений. Свойство transition задает трансформацию свойств во времени, animation генерирует сложные последовательности.

JavaScript и фронтенд‑логика: отзывчивость и изменчивость

JavaScript конвертирует фиксированные страницы в интерактивные программы. Язык выполняется в браузере и отвечает на действия пользователя. Щелчки, пролистывание, набор содержимого — все происшествия выполняются сценариями в моментальном времени.

Работа DOM позволяет изменять контент без перезагрузки. Программы вносят, стирают или модифицируют блоки, меняют оформление и атрибуты. Пользователь наблюдает моментальные модификации при взаимодействии с UI.

Перехват событий формирует базис взаимодействия. Перехватчики ловят нажатия мыши, удары клавиш, передачу форм. Callback-функции выполняются при появлении происшествия и реализуют нужную логику.

Неблокирующие запросы получают сведения без обновления страницы. Fetch API направляет обращения к серверу и извлекает данные. Промисы и async/await упрощают обращение с асинхронным кодом.

Коллекции и фреймворки повышают проектирование. React, Vue, Angular предлагают средства для формирования модулей. Современные vulkan russia выстраиваются на базе этих решений для обеспечения производительности.

Серверная область: бэкенд, базы данных и API

Бэкенд реализует бизнес-логику и оперирует данными на сервере. Серверные языки исполняют вычисления, проверяют полномочия входа, генерируют результаты. PHP, Python, Node.js, Java — распространённые средства для создания серверной части.

Репозитории сведений хранят структурированную данные. Реляционные системы MySQL, PostgreSQL упорядочивают сведения в таблицы со связями. NoSQL-решения MongoDB, Redis используют объекты или комбинации ключ-значение.

API обеспечивает обмен между фронтендом и бэкендом. RESTful API применяет HTTP-методы для действий: GET для приёма, POST для формирования, PUT для обновления, DELETE для стирания. GraphQL даёт извлекать лишь требуемые параметры.

Проверка подлинности и разграничение ограждают доступ к данным. Сеансы, токены JWT, OAuth предоставляют определение посетителей. Серверный код валидирует полномочия перед исполнением процедур.

Платформы ускоряют проектирование бэкенда. Django, Laravel, Express.js дают библиотеки для маршрутизации и работы с базами. Текущие вулкан россия используют микросервисную организацию для распределения функциональности на автономные компоненты.

Сборщики, каркасы и модули: текущий арсенал разработки

Актуальная создание основывается на технологии автоматизации и подготовленные средства. Сборщики компонентов компонуют документы, оптимизируют код, уменьшают вес. Webpack, Vite, Parcel преобразуют JavaScript, CSS, графику и создают результирующие пакеты.

Каркасы дают организационные паттерны для формирования решений. React использует блочный способ и виртуальный DOM. Vue объединяет простоту с мощными средствами. Angular предлагает экосистему для enterprise решений.

Блочная архитектура разбивает оболочку на самостоятельные элементы. Каждый модуль заключает разметку, стили и логику. Переиспользование компонентов ускоряет создание.

Ключевые средства текущего стека охватывают:

  • Управляющие библиотек npm, yarn для администрирования зависимостями
  • Транспайлеры Babel для обеспечения современных возможностей
  • Проверяльщики ESLint, Prettier для проверки стандарта
  • Платформы управления версий Git для командной взаимодействия

TypeScript вносит строгую типизацию к JavaScript. Валидация типов устраняет дефекты. Нынешние вулкан россия массово применяют TypeScript для усиления стабильности кодовой основы.

Эффективность, охрана и расширение площадок

Скорость сказывается на клиентский опыт и позиции в поиске. Сжатие изображений, компрессия кода, постепенная скачивание ReduceReduceReduceReduceReduceReduceReduceReduceReduceуменьшают длительность отклика. Кеширование удерживает данные для быстрого получения без дублирующих расчётов.

Охрана ограждает данные пользователей и неприкосновенность приложения. HTTPS кодирует транспортировку информации. Проверка входных информации блокирует SQL-инъекции и XSS-атаки. Content Security Policy сужает провайдеры подгружаемых ресурсов.

Аутентификация двухэтапная повышает надежность безопасности аккаунтов. Кодирование паролей создаёт невозможным получение исходных параметров при компрометации. Регулярные патчи библиотек исправляют бреши.

Масштабирование обеспечивает надёжную деятельность при увеличении нагрузки. Горизонтальное рост подключает узлы для распределения требований. Балансировщики нагрузки делят запросы между узлами.

Отслеживание фиксирует индикаторы производительности и достижимости. Логирование записывает события для анализа проблем. Текущие вулкан россии задействуют платформы наблюдения для быстрого выявления неполадок и автоматического исправления.

Облачная инфраструктура, CDN и беспрерывная развёртывание изменений

Облачные сервисы обеспечивают серверные мощности по требованию. AWS, Google Cloud, Microsoft Azure дают использовать узлы и базы данных без покупки железа. Гибкость автоматически подстраивает мощности под нагрузку.

CDN повышает раздачу наполнения посетителям. Системы раздачи кэшируют неизменные документы на машинах в множественных точках. Запрос обрабатывается соседним узлом, уменьшая период подгрузки.

Контейнеризация облегчает установку приложений. Docker оборачивает код обособленные изолированные контейнеры. Kubernetes координирует ростом и предоставляет живучесть.

CI/CD механизирует развёртывание апдейтов. Непрерывная интеграция запускает тесты при каждом коммите. Непрерывное деплой внедряет обновления после удачных проверок. GitLab CI, GitHub Actions осуществляют формирование и публикацию.

Инфраструктура как код фиксирует настройки в документах. Terraform, Ansible генерируют объекты автоматически. Современные vulkan russia эксплуатируют автоматизацию для оперативного запуска и масштабирования приложений.

Author:

Share:

Lukki Casino

Как построены нынешние площадки

Be the first to comment “Как устроены текущие площадки”

(will not be shared)

0
YOUR CART
  • No products in the cart.